How to Shield Your Personal Information in the Digital Age

Protecting your details online requires consistent effort. First, strengthen your passwords; use unique combinations and avoid reusing them across various accounts. Be extremely cautious about opening links in unsolicited emails or messages – they might be phishing attempts to gain your credentials. Review your privacy settings on social media platforms and restrict the amount of personal content you publish. Finally, consider using a reliable virtual private connection to shield your web activity, especially when using public Wi-Fi.

Simple Steps to Secure Your Online Accounts

Protecting your digital profile doesn’t require complicated. Begin by setting unique codes for each platform you use. Don't recycling passwords across different accounts, as this creates a major threat. Turn on two-factor authentication wherever offered; this includes an additional form of defense. Finally, be cautious of phishing emails and unusual URLs and avoid sharing personal data unless you’re positive of the source.
